Output 89c868001aa30174762d796b2b69f04854099e203e3aaab42e471de59d8bdb8a:0

value
9866795
script pubkey
OP_0 OP_PUSHBYTES_20 9d40ad7f10d98e79402134e1ef8ecccdd3cc084f
address
bc1qn4q26lcsmx88jsppxns7lrkvehfuczz0j2yh0x
transaction
89c868001aa30174762d796b2b69f04854099e203e3aaab42e471de59d8bdb8a
spent
true